Why Choose Sunset Beach for Your Next Vacation?

Sunset Beach, North Carolina, consistently ranks as a top destination for those seeking pristine beaches and a relaxed atmosphere. The island's unique east-west orientation allows visitors to experience both sunrises and sunsets over the ocean, a rare treat that few other east coast beaches can offer. Family-Friendly Activities

Sunset Beach is a haven for families, offering a variety of activities beyond the beach. The Kindred Spirit Mailbox, a beloved landmark, encourages visitors to share their thoughts and dreams. The Ingram Planetarium offers educational programs, and the nearby barrier islands provide opportunities for kayaking, paddleboarding, and exploring untouched maritime forests. Setting Your Budget

Before diving into listings, establish a clear budget. Remember to account for the rental rate, taxes, cleaning fees, and any optional add-ons like pet fees or pool heating. Seasonal demand significantly impacts pricing; peak summer months are typically the most expensive. Data from vacation rental platforms indicates that prices can fluctuate by 30-50% between peak and off-peak seasons.

Best Time to Book

For peak season (June-August), we recommend booking 6-12 months in advance, especially for larger homes or oceanfront properties. Shoulder seasons (April-May, September-October) offer more flexibility and often better rates, with booking 3-6 months out usually sufficient. For last-minute deals during off-season, check within 1-2 months of your desired dates.

What are typical check-in/check-out procedures for rentals?

Most rentals offer keyless entry with a door code, or a lockbox. Check-in is usually in the late afternoon (e.g., 4 PM), and check-out is in the late morning (e.g., 10 AM). You'll receive specific instructions from your rental company or owner regarding procedures, which often include light tidying and trash removal.

Are linens and towels typically provided in Sunset Beach rentals?

While many premium Sunset Beach vacation rentals now include linens and towels as part of their service, it is not universal. Always verify this detail in the property description or with the rental agency. If not included, you may need to bring your own or arrange for a rental service.
